IL-495 Prior to Old Georgetown Road
Bethesda, MD – Friday, September 4th, 2009, Engine 710, Truck 710, and Ambulance 710 responded to an accident on the Inner Loop of the Beltway at 3:00PM. The units on-scene worked swiftly to secure each patient and transport them to the hospital. The accident was deemed to be cause by driver negligence. This is an important reminder for every driver to be alert and vigilant while driving their vehicles.
76th Street Auto Fire
Cabin John, MD – 1700 hrs on Tuesday February 24, 2007: the Cabin John Park Fire department responded for the car fire in the 7900 block of 76th street. Engine 710 arrived on scene with Ambulance 710 to find a car fully engulfed in fire. After further investigation, the fire was deemed to have been started by a cigarette that fell in the passenger compartment. Engine 710 quickly mobilized water resources to extinguish the car fire. The automobile fire took a total of one hour to successfully extinguish and clean up. There was irreparable damage to the car but luckily, no one was hurt.
